Wilton Corporation had beginning retained earnings of $724,000 and ending retained earnings of $833,000. During the year, it issued common stock totaling $47,000 and paid dividends of $50,000. What was its net income for the year?

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

The ending retained earnings = beginning retained earnings + net income - Dividends Paid

Net income = ending retained earnings - beginning retained earnings + Dividends Paid

= $833,000 - $724,000 + $50,000

= $159000.

Therefore, the net income for the year is $159000.
